The Christmas Club
Two busy strangers meet when they help an elderly woman find her lost Christmas savings. Thanks to fate and Christmas magic, they also find something they were both missing: true love.

Too cheesy and drawn out, even if it does bring sweetness by the end. Elizabeth Mitchell and Cameron Mathison are probably the best thing about 'The Christmas Club', they have a fairly cute dynamic as Olivia and Edward. The support cast aren't noteworthy, though the kid actors do lighten up the film. It could've done with a lot less cheese though, especially early on. I wouldn't class it as good, but it's not bad either.
